AceShowbiz - Shannen Doherty, known for her roles in "Charmed" and "Beverly Hills, 90210," passed away on Saturday, July 13, after a courageous battle with cancer. Celebrities and fans took to social media to express their grief and to celebrate the actress's legacy.
"A true lion heart. What a warrior," Rose McGowan who starred in "Charmed" with Doherty remembered the late star in an Instagram comment. "Your daddy is holding his best girl now. Love to your mama, your dog and all who love you fiercely."
Alyssa Milano, who acted alongside Doherty in "Charmed," also released a statement. Despite their well-documented tensions, Milano recognized Doherty as "a talented actress" and offered her condolences, "The world is less without her. My condolences to all who loved her."
Viola Davis commented under PEOPLE's Instagram post, "Oh man! So sad. Rest in peace," while Olivia Munn shared heartbreak emoji and a tribute on her Instagram Story, recalling their bond over a shared battle with breast cancer. "We became instant friends - which I honestly couldn't comprehend at times because watching her on 90210 was everything to me when I was 10," Munn wrote.
Eric West, who acted alongside Doherty in 2021's "Fortress", reminisced on X (formerly Twitter) about her "warm energy and positive vibes." Filmmaker Don Bluth shared a heartfelt message alongside a photo from Doherty's childhood, lauding her as an "amazing woman" who is now "safe at home with the angels."
Similarly, Kevin Smith, who directed Doherty in "Mallrats", fondly remembered her as a "true talent" and a "good friend," highlighting her as the reason the film got green-lit in 1995.
Reactions from Doherty's "Beverly Hills, 90210" co-stars were especially moving. Jason Priestley, who portrayed Brandon Walsh, expressed his sorrow on Instagram, citing her as a "force of nature." Brian Austin Green, who shared a close bond with her, called her "My sister. You loved me through everything." Gabrielle Carteris, referencing their late co-star Luke Perry, wrote, "I know Luke is there with open arms to love you."
Addressing the past, Doherty had once spoken to PEOPLE about rebuilding her relationships with her "90210" castmates, now as adults with deeper understanding. "There was never any sit-down, like hey let's talk about this. It was just, we're adults, we're in a different place. You kind of start over, but you start over closer," she explained.
